11.325(a)(3)(iii) and 11.327: the third approved training item — management of electrical and electronic control equipment. High voltage, automation, and the isolation that keeps people alive.
The engine room stopped being a mechanical space some time ago. On a modern large yacht the plant is a network with engines attached to it: distributed control, redundant PLCs, a power management system deciding on its own which generator to start, and somewhere in the middle of it a switchboard that can kill you before you finish the sentence.
The Coast Guard's answer to that is a management-level training item with a very deliberate word in the title. Not operation of electrical and electronic control equipment. Management of it.
What management means here
- You do not have to be the person with the meter in their hand. You have to be the person who knows whether the person with the meter is competent to hold it.
- Isolation is a system, not an action. Who authorises it, who verifies it, who holds the key, who proves dead, and who is permitted to restore. If that answer lives in one person's head, it is not a system.
- Automation hides faults. A power management system that keeps the lights on through a developing fault has, in a real sense, concealed it from you. The alarm history is a maintenance record. Read it.
- Redundancy is a claim until it is tested. Two of everything is worth nothing if both are fed from the same board, the same cooling loop, or the same lube-oil supply. Trace it yourself. On paper. Once.
WARNING — High voltage does not forgive The competence exists because people die. Safe isolation, proving dead, lock-out and permit to work are not paperwork — they are the machinery. The specific HV procedures on your vessel come from the equipment manufacturer, the vessel's safety management system and the flag state's rules, and this course does not attempt to restate them.
Take the approved course. Read your own vessel's HV procedure. Then read it again when you join a new boat, because it will be different.
Why the ETO is next door
The Coast Guard issues an Electro-technical Officer endorsement (11.335) at operational level, with a 750 kW floor. Its professional training list is the electrical department in six lines: onboard computer networking and security; radio electronics; integrated navigation equipment; ship propulsion and auxiliary machinery; instrumentation and control systems; and high-voltage power systems.
That is the deep specialist. You are not required to be them — and on most yachts you will not have one. Which is precisely why the management item exists: to make sure the chief can hold, supervise and question that domain even when there is nobody aboard who owns it full-time.
TIP — The ETO is the one free-standing STCW engineering credential — and management holders can pick it up 11.335(d): an applicant holding no other national or STCW endorsement receives the ETO endorsement without any corresponding national endorsement. There is no national ETO grade — 11.501 lists thirteen and ETO is not among them. It is the only exception to the rule at 11.201(a) that STCW rides on a national ticket.
And 11.335(c): a holder of OICEW, Second Engineer Officer or Chief Engineer Officer "will be allowed to receive the ETO endorsement upon completion of the requirements in Section A-III/6." If the electrical side is where your career is going, that door is open from where you already stand.
The habit to build
Every time an automated system does something clever on your behalf, ask what it just hid. A generator that started itself, a pump that swapped over, a breaker that reclosed. The plant is telling you something and the alarm panel is the only place it can say it.
The chief who reads the alarm history is the chief who is not surprised.
